A Vegetarian Delight — For those seeking a no- meat centerpiece that doesn’t compromise on taste or elegance, stuffed acorn squash is an excellent choice. With its vibrant colors and hearty flavors, this dish is as pleasing to the eyes as it is to the palate. Fill halved acorn squash with a delectable mixture of quinoa, vegetables, dried fruits and nuts, creating a symphony of textures and flavors. Roasted to perfection, the squash becomes tender and adds a touch of sweetness. Serve it alongside a refreshing citrus salad and crusty bread for a well-rounded vegetarian holiday feast. A Vegan Showstopper — For a stunning vegan alternative, a whole roasted cauliflower can take center stage. Choose a large cauliflower head, coat it in a savory spice blend and roast it to perfection. The result is a golden-brown exterior with a tender, melt-in-your-mouth interior. Serve it with a drizzle of tahini sauce and sprinkle it with pomegranate seeds, chopped pistachios and fresh herbs for a vibrant and visually striking dish.
